Pasarea is a hauntingly raw drama that dives deep into the dark world of human trafficking. The atmosphere is thick with despair, yet there's a flicker of hope as Vera navigates her harrowing circumstances. The pacing is deliberate, allowing the weight of each moment to settle, and the performances feel genuine, almost uncomfortably real. You can sense the director's intention to strip away glamor, focusing instead on the stark realities of survival. There's a distinctive absence of flashy effects, relying instead on powerful storytelling and emotional depth. Vera's journey is both heart-wrenching and illuminating, making you reflect on the resilience of the human spirit amidst unimaginable adversity.
